Why is the calling of Christ's Bride important for Christians?
Answered in 1 source
The calling of Christ's Bride symbolizes the redemptive work of the Gospel and the relationship between Christ and believers.
The calling of Christ's Bride is significant for Christians as it represents the divine initiative in redemption through the Gospel. This calling illustrates that believers are chosen and called out of darkness into light, symbolizing their relationship with Christ. Genesis 24 poignantly captures this theme, as the servant seeks a bride for Isaac, paralleling the Gospel call extended to Christ's people. In doing so, it affirms that God actively draws His people to Himself, ensuring that they are embraced in the family of God, with all the accompanying blessings of grace, salvation, and eternal inheritance.
